This is a wrapper/port of Professor Layton: Lost Future HD for the PS Vita.
The port works by loading the official Android ARMv7 executables in memory, resolving its imports with native functions and patching it in order to properly run. By doing so, it's basically as if we emulate a minimalist Android environment in which we run natively the executable as is.

- This port works only with versions of the game where an obb file was still used. It has been tested with v.1.0.1.
- Post puzzle solution animation is a bit slow. (Likely cause of I/O overhead)
- Very rarely, videos play sped up and without audio and can freeze although you are still able to skip them in order to progress the game. (sceAvPlayer qwirk).
In order to properly install the game, you'll have to follow these steps precisely:
- Install kubridge and FdFix by copying
kubridge.skprx
andfd_fix.skprx
to your taiHEN plugins folder (usuallyux0:tai
) and adding two entries to yourconfig.txt
under*KERNEL
:
*KERNEL
ux0:tai/kubridge.skprx
ux0:tai/fd_fix.skprx
Note Don't install fd_fix.skprx if you're using rePatch plugin
- Optional: Install PSVshell to overclock your device to 500Mhz.
- Install
libshacccg.suprx
, if you don't have it already, by following this guide. - Obtain your copy of Professor Layton: Lost Future HD legally for Android in form of an
.apk
file and an obb. You can get all the required files directly from your phone or by using an apk extractor you can find in the play store. - Open the apk with your zip explorer and extract the file
libll3.so
from thelib/armeabi-v7a
folder toux0:data/layton_future
. - Extract the folder
assets
insideux0:data/layton_future
. - Extract the
obb
file inux0:data/layton_future/data
and rename the filemain.obb
.
